Вопросы по теме 'regexp-replace'
Проблема с обратной ссылкой в TCL
У меня есть следующий код:
set a "10.20.30.40"
regsub -all {.([0-9]+).([0-9]+).} $a {\2 \1} b
Я пытаюсь найти 2-й и 3-й октет IP-адреса.
Ожидаемый результат:
20 30
Фактический результат:
20 04 0
В чем здесь моя ошибка?
871 просмотров
schedule
23.02.2023
преобразование данных с регулярным выражением в Oracle sql
У меня есть данные, как показано ниже, с ограниченными вкладками. Я представил их здесь с целью
with t_view as (select '6-21 6-21 6-21 6-21 6-21 6-21 6-21 ' as col from dual
union
select '6-20 6-20 6-20 6-20 6-20 ' from dual
union...
994 просмотров
schedule
10.07.2023
Удалить строки из текстового файла
У меня есть текстовый файл, из которого я хочу исключить строки, начинающиеся с цифр от 1 до 9. Я пытался заменить их пустыми (пустыми строками) с помощью регулярных выражений ^\d+(.*)$ и ^[1-9](.*)$ , но это не работает.
Я использую команду...
197 просмотров
schedule
20.01.2023
Преобразовать верхние символы в нижние и нижние в верхние (наоборот)
Мне нужно преобразовать все нижние символы в верхние и все верхние в нижние в некоторой строке.
Например
var testString = 'heLLoWorld';
Должно быть
'HEllOwORLD'
после преобразования.
Каков самый элегантный способ реализовать...
2781 просмотров
schedule
05.05.2023
Обновление синтаксиса переменных в оракуле
У нас есть таблица с именем TEMPLATES , в которой хранятся HTML-шаблоны электронной почты в виде обычного текста. В этой таблице есть несколько столбцов, но нас интересует столбец TEMPLATE , в котором хранится текст.
Недавно мы обновили...
50 просмотров
schedule
21.03.2023
Улучшение пользовательской функции Excel RegExp путем поиска и замены по списку
У меня есть простая пользовательская функция vba в excel, которая заменяет текст на RegEx:
Function RegExReplace (SearchPattern As String, TextToSearch As String, _
ReplacePattern As String, _...
547 просмотров
schedule
24.07.2023
регулярное выражение tcl, связанное с сочетанием символов и чисел
Мой файл содержит
roll_number : someNumber ; name(mixOfcharactersAndNumbers) filePathInLinux
такие как
roll_number : 81 ; name(JOHN_23_CARTER) /home/directory/johnc
roll_number : 22 ; name(michael21_Lee) /home/directory/mhlee
Мое...
95 просмотров
schedule
12.04.2023
Oracle Regexp_replace строка
Скажем, у меня есть следующая строка:
notNull(devhx_8_other2_name_2) AND notNull(devhx_8_other2_amt)
Как я могу использовать regexp_replace , чтобы изменить его на:
(devhx_8_other2_name_2) is not null AND (devhx_8_other2_amt) is...
737 просмотров
schedule
22.03.2022
Проблема с REGEXP_REPLACE в MySQL 8
Недавно я обновился до MySQL 8, чтобы использовать новые функции регулярных выражений ( https://dev.mysql.com/doc/refman/8.0/en/regexp.html ), чтобы очистить много плохих адресов. Однако у меня возникают проблемы с использованием REGEXP_REPLACE.
Я...
2123 просмотров
schedule
01.02.2023
Regexp для удаления всех пробелов и цифр
Я пытаюсь использовать регулярное выражение в инструкции sql, чтобы удалить все пробелы и цифры из строки «текст», которая может выглядеть как
1. 000000123456 (No space)
2. 00000 123456 (spaces in the beginning and end of string)
3. 90330000 45...
266 просмотров
schedule
15.12.2022
ошибка перегруженного значения метода regexp_replace с альтернативами
Я пытаюсь заменить символ "/" пробелом ("") из данных в столбце с именем UserAgent в фрейме данных df_test
Данные в столбце выглядят так:
Mozilla / 5.0 (Windows NT 6.1; WOW64; Trident / 7.0; rv: 11.0) как Gecko
Я пробовал использовать
val...
1057 просмотров
schedule
30.04.2022
Как определить слова, которые нужно заменить, на основе нескольких условий с помощью REGEXP_REPLACE в Oracle SQL?
Таблица состоит из столбцов: слова и предложения. Я пытаюсь заменить слова в предложениях ссылкой (состоящей из слова и его идентификатора), если слова существуют в столбце слов. Приведенный ниже код отлично заменяет. Но мне нужна помощь, чтобы...
64 просмотров
schedule
19.05.2024
Как заменить слово, которое не помещается между шаблоном с помощью Oracle REGEXP, и не то же слово внутри шаблона?
Я пытаюсь заменить слово «группа», когда оно не находится между шаблоном <a href и a> на «группа1». Ниже запрос заменяет «группу» внутри желаемого шаблона. Как заменить слово, которое находится вне шаблона?
with t as (
select...
63 просмотров
schedule
23.05.2022
Сравнение значений, разделенных запятыми, из двух столбцов двух разных таблиц
Я хочу сравнить значения двух столбцов (таблица различий) с разделенными запятыми значениями двух разных таблиц Oracle. Я хочу найти строки, которые соответствуют всем значениям ( NAME1 все значения должны соответствовать NAME2 значениям)....
187 просмотров
schedule
15.04.2023
несколько регулярных выражений в одном вводе
привет, у меня есть один тип ввода tel для номера мобильного телефона, и мне нравится использовать шаблон для числового формата, подобного этому 938 119 1229 , но когда я использую тип tel, я могу использовать слово во вводе, я пытаюсь использовать...
105 просмотров
schedule
13.11.2022
Расставьте акценты между значениями, используемыми для REGEXREPLACE (Google Таблицы)
У меня есть такая формула:
=ARRAYFORMULA(UNIQUE(TRIM(TRANSPOSE(SPLIT(QUERY(TRANSPOSE(QUERY(TRANSPOSE(
REGEXREPLACE(REGEXEXTRACT(INDIRECT("T2:T"&COUNTA(T2:T)+1), REPT("(.)",
LEN(INDIRECT("T2:T"&COUNTA(T2:T)+1)))), "['A-Za-z\.-]",...
29 просмотров
schedule
31.05.2022
Регулярное выражение: добавить пробел после числа, если за ним следует буква
После набора чисел я хотел бы добавить пробел в строку. Например, следующие строки должны добавлять пробел после числа:
Before After
"0ABCD TECHNOLOGIES SERVICES" "0 ABCD TECHNOLOGIES SERVICES"...
1126 просмотров
schedule
21.03.2022
REGEXP REPLACE teradata для устранения числовых слов, появляющихся в поле адреса.
Я хочу извлечь название улицы и тип из поля адреса.
Input = expected output
3/14 MARKDOWN ST = MARKDOWN ST
22-23 MARKDOWN ST = MARKDOWN ST
33C MARKDOWN ST = MARKDOWN ST
33 MARKDOWN VENUE ST = MARKDOWN ST
44/11 MARKDOWN AVE = MARKDOWN AVE
Я...
62 просмотров
schedule
24.07.2023
REGEXP REPLACE с обратной косой чертой в Spark-SQL
У меня есть строка, содержащая ключевое слово \s\. Теперь я хочу заменить его на NULL.
select string,REGEXP_REPLACE(string,'\\\s\\','') from test
Но невозможно заменить приведенным выше оператором в spark sql
ввод: \s\help вывод: help...
1209 просмотров
schedule
14.06.2023
Перевод MySQL REGEXP_REPLACE из PCRE REGEXP
Я пытаюсь извлечь объем строкового поля для численной сортировки по нему.
Учитывая следующие данные:
Что-то на 300 мл
300мл что-то
Что-то особенное (с 300 мл)
8-v то, что не должно совпадать
Первая попытка: просто приведите...
104 просмотров
schedule
01.01.2023